As things stand, Ethereum continues to hold its own among the DeFi sector in terms of total value locked (TVL), with 57% of the total sector worth $31.14 billion. Tron (TRX) follows in second place at 10.39% and $5.59 billion meanwhile, BNB Smart Chain (BSC) ranks third at $5.38 billion with 10.01% of the total worth, according to data retrieved by Finbold from Defi Llama on October 12.  It’s also worth mentioning that Ethereum leads the number of protocols with 576 followed by BSC with 482, while third is Polygon (MATIC) with 319, interestingly, TRON ranks tenth out of the top 10 with ten protocols.

Ethereum is the ‘foundation of the internet’

Notably, leading economist at blockchain firm Consensys, David Shuttleworth, suggested that Ethereum (ETH) is now the ‘foundation of the internet,’ a factor validated by the recent Merge upgrade that transitioned the network to a Proof-of-Stake (PoS) protocol.  According to Shuttleworth, Ethereum can power more businesses, referencing the network’s ability to process more transactions than established platforms like Visa (NYSE: V). Earlier this year Bloomberg’s senior commodities analyst Mike McGlone, suggested that the price of ETH will continue to go up as it is “becoming the internet’s collateral.” It’s worth mentioning that Finbold reported on October 11, the supply of Ethereum in circulation has dropped by nearly 4,000 ETH in two days. With a lower supply of a digital asset in circulation means that fewer of it is available as the asset starts to become deflationary.
